Qualities Of Good Marketing Manager

A marketing manager plays a pivotal role in the success of any advertising campaign or marketing strategy. They are responsible for planning, implementing, and overseeing all marketing activities to ensure that the company’s goals and objectives are met. To be effective in this role, a marketing manager must possess several key qualities that enable them to excel in their job. In this article, we will explore some of the essential qualities of a good marketing manager.

1. Strategic Thinking

One of the most important qualities of a good marketing manager is the ability to think strategically. They must have a deep understanding of the market, target audience, and competition in order to develop effective marketing strategies. A marketing manager should be able to identify trends, analyze data, and make informed decisions that align with the overall objectives of the company. They should also have the foresight to anticipate changes in the industry and adapt their strategies accordingly.

2. Creativity

Another crucial quality of a good marketing manager is creativity. They need to be able to think outside the box and come up with innovative ideas to capture the attention of the target audience. Creativity is essential in developing memorable and engaging advertising campaigns that will leave a lasting impression on consumers. A marketing manager should be able to brainstorm and collaborate with a creative team to develop unique concepts that stand out from the competition.

3. Excellent Communication Skills

Effective communication is key for a marketing manager to succeed in their role. They need to be able to articulate their ideas clearly and persuasively to both clients and internal teams. Good communication skills also enable them to build strong relationships with stakeholders and ensure that everyone is on the same page. A marketing manager should be adept at presenting ideas, negotiating contracts, and resolving conflicts when they arise.

4. Analytical Abilities

A good marketing manager should possess strong analytical skills to analyze data and assess the success of marketing campaigns. They should be able to measure key performance indicators (KPIs) and make data-driven decisions to optimize future marketing strategies. Analytical abilities also help them identify patterns and trends in consumer behavior, allowing for more targeted and effective marketing efforts.

5. Leadership Skills

Leadership is an essential quality for a marketing manager as they are responsible for guiding and motivating their team towards achieving the company’s marketing goals. They should inspire their team members, delegate tasks effectively, and provide constructive feedback to help them grow professionally. A good marketing manager should lead by example and create a positive work environment that fosters creativity and collaboration.

6. Strong Digital Marketing Knowledge

In today’s digital age, a good marketing manager must have a strong understanding of digital marketing strategies and tools. They should be familiar with social media marketing, search engine optimization (SEO), content marketing, and other digital advertising techniques. This knowledge is crucial in developing integrated marketing campaigns that effectively reach the target audience across various digital platforms.

14. What metrics should a marketing manager focus on when evaluating campaign performance?

A marketing manager should focus on metrics such as click-through rates (CTR), conversion rates, return on ad spend (ROAS), cost per acquisition (CPA), customer lifetime value (CLTV), and overall ROI. These metrics provide insights into the effectiveness and efficiency of the campaign.
